About Nariida Smith
Nariida Smith is a scholar working on Building and Construction, Transportation, Automotive Engineering,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ment and Strategy and Management, having authored 26 papers that have together received 317 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Urban and Freight Transport Logistics (10 papers), Energy, Environment, and Transportation Policies (8 papers), Urban Transport and Accessibility (8 papers), Transportation Planning and Optimization (6 papers), Vehicle emissions and performance (5 papers), Transport and Economic Policies (5 papers), Transportation and Mobility Innovations (4 papers) and Economic and Environmental Valuation (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Transportation (107 citations), Geophysics (64 citations), Automotive Engineering (47 citations), Building and Construction (51 citations) and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(50 citations). Nariida Smith has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, New Zealand and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Leorey Marquez, K. Vozoff, David A. Hensher, R.J. Fleming, John M. Rose, Andrew T. Collins, Garland Chow, Luís Ferreira, Luís Ferreira and John R. Roy. Their work appears in journals such as Transport Reviews, European journal of transport and infrastructure research, Journal of transport economics and policy, Transportation Research Part E Logistics and Transportation Review and Environmental Modelling & Software.
